Why Silver Spring Homes Are Different
Silver Spring grew fast as a DC streetcar suburb between the 1920s and 1950s, and that building wave left dense pockets of brick Colonials, Cape Cods, and bungalows in Woodside and Sligo Park Hills with original single-wythe masonry chimneys. Many were built for coal, later converted to gas or oil without a liner swap. The clay tiles inside were sized and sooted for a fuel that hasn’t burned in them for decades. When a homeowner renovates and reopens a fireplace that’s been dormant since the 1980s, the liner is often cracked, the crown is spalling, and the setup now violates Montgomery County code the moment a permit gets pulled.
The DC metro climate makes it worse. We oscillate around freezing 40 to 60 times per winter rather than staying consistently cold, so water seeps into hairline crown cracks, freezes, expands, and pops the mortar. Silver Spring’s humid summers then add moss and efflorescence on shaded north-facing chimney faces, especially in the Sligo Creek watershed neighborhoods where lots are wooded and damp. Technicians working older Silver Spring cores also regularly find two appliances sharing one unlined flue, a configuration that was grandfathered for decades but triggers a code violation on any permitted renovation.

A cap and crown are the two parts of a Silver Spring chimney most exposed to weather, and our freeze-thaw cycles destroy them faster than almost any other climate pattern in the country. Cracked crowns let water into the brick below, and a missing or rusted cap lets rain, birds, and debris straight down the flue. In Woodside and Sligo Park Hills, we regularly find crowns that haven’t been sealed since the house was built. How long does a chimney cap last in Silver Spring?
Fifteen to twenty years for stainless steel, less for galvanized caps in Silver Spring’s wet, humid climate. Annual inspection of the cap and crown is the cheapest protection you can buy.
Does a cracked crown need immediate replacement?
Not always. Hairline cracks can be sealed; full spalling or a crown that’s separated from the brick requires recasting. We quote based on photos and a written scope, not a guess.
Chimney Liner & Rebuild in Silver Spring

Silver Spring’s older homes often still have the original clay tile liner sized for coal, now venting a gas furnace or a wood-burning fireplace it was never built for. That’s a combustion and carbon monoxide risk, and Montgomery County code requires correction when a renovation permit is pulled. Do I need a new liner if I only burn wood occasionally?
If the existing clay liner is cracked or sized for coal, yes. Occasional use still sends heat and combustion gases through damaged flue walls into the home’s structure.
